Perturbation Theory and Control in Classical or Quantum Mechanics by an Inversion Formula | Michel Vittot
; | Date: |
22 Mar 2003 | Subject: | Mathematical Physics; Dynamical Systems; Optimization and Control | math-ph math.DS math.MP math.OC | Affiliation: | Centre de Physique Theorique, CNRS Luminy, Marseille, France | Abstract: | We consider a perturbation of an ``integrable’’ Hamiltonian and give an expression for the canonical or unitary transformation which ``simplifies’’ this perturbed system. The problem is to invert a functional defined on the Lie- algebra of observables. We give a bound for the perturbation in order to solve this inversion. And apply this result to a particular case of the control theory, as a first example, and to the ``quantum adiabatic transformation’’, as another example. | Source: | arXiv, math-ph/0303051 | Services: | Forum | Review | PDF | Favorites |
